While a lot of Individual retirement accounts purchase standard possessions like stocks or mutual funds, the tax code likewise allows unique "self-directed" or "alternative-asset" Individual retirement accounts that can hold physical silver or gold. However not all precious metals are permitted. gold 401k rollover - work directly with owners. In reality, the law names specific gold, silver and platinum coins that qualify like the American Gold Eagle and specifies pureness requirements for gold, silver, platinum or palladium bars in such accounts.

The tax code also says the gold or silver must be held by an IRS-approved custodian or trustee, though some gold IRA marketers claim there's a loophole in this law (more about this later). But the evidence is mixed on whether owning gold can actually keep your savings safe. For starters, while gold can provide some insurance against inflation, just how much depends upon your timing and perseverance. "Gold does tend to hold its worth in the long-term, however it is likewise unstable approximately as volatile as stocks so you might need decades to ride out its ups and downs," states Campbell Harvey, the J.

" So gold would be at the bottom of the list for individuals who are retired or close to retirement." From 1981 through 2000, for example, when inflation almost doubled, gold went more or less sideways. Then in this century, the metal truly removed - can rollover my 401k to gold. It rose by more than 500% from January 2000 (when it traded at around $280 per ounce) to a high of approximately $1,900 in August 2011, while inflation climbed up only 34%. Ever since, however, gold has fallen by about a third in value, to around $1,270 an ounce in mid-June, while inflation edged up 8%.

The Lear Capital TV advertisement, for example, says that, "if silver simply returns to half of its all-time high, it would be a 60% boost." Fair enough. But if it drooped to around twice its recent low, you would suffer an extremely unpleasant 50% loss. That's why even investors who usually favor gold, such as Russ Koesterich, a portfolio supervisor for the Black, Rock Global Allocation Fund, encourage you to deal with precious metals with the exact same caution you would any other physical property, such as real estate. In time, home tends to rise in worth. But in a down market, like the 2008 recession, people can lose their t-shirts and houses to dropping costs. 401k to gold rollover no penalty.

Where is gold headed? Investment pros offer no consensus (can i rollover my 401k into gold). Koesterich states a modest quantity of gold in a portfolio (state, 3 to 5%) may assist offer diversification if other assets downturn. But Harvey and former commodities trader Claude Erb argue that gold's huge gain throughout the 2000s left the metal extremely overvalued compared to historical standards. In a paper released in 2015, they computed that if gold returned to its "fair value" compared to inflation over the next ten years, it would lose about 4. 4% a year. "You can go out and purchase a Treasury Inflation-Protected Security, or IDEAS, that will offer you the same return with a lot less volatility," Erb explains.

Treasury bond whose principal is ensured to increase with inflation.) The SUGGESTIONS comparison brings up one key distinction between rare-earth elements and other investments: they have no income stream, such as the interest on a bond or dividends from a stock, to cushion their rate swings. What's more, valuable metals have significant purchase and holding costs that stocks and bonds don't share. For beginners, there are base costs and storage costs. At Rosland Capital, you'll pay a one-time $50 cost to open an account and around $225 a year to shop and insure your holdings at a protected depository in northern Delaware.

However they make that cash back on an even more significant expense: the "spread," or gap between the wholesale rate the company pays to get the metal and the retail rate it charges you as a purchaser. Lear Capital, for example, just recently offered an Individual Retirement Account Bonus offer Program that picked up $500 of costs for customers who bought at least $50,000 in silver or gold. However the company's Deal Arrangement stated the spread on coins and bullion offered to IRA clients "normally" ranged in between 17 and 33%. So if the spread were 17%, a client who opened a $50,000 Individual Retirement Account would pay $8,500 for the spread and get just $41,500 in wholesale-value gold which left a lot of margin for Lear to recoup that $500 reward.

If you sell the gold or silver to a third-party dealership, you could lose cash on another spread, due to the fact that dealerships normally wish to pay less than what they think they can get for the metal on the open market (gold 401k rollover - work directly with owners). To assist consumers avoid that risk, some IRA companies will buy back your gold at, say, the then-prevailing wholesale rate. However, thanks to the initial spread our hypothetical financier paid to open her $50,000 Individual Retirement Account, she would require gold prices to rise by over 20% simply to recover cost. Compare that to the expense of a standard IRA, where opening and closing an account is frequently free and deals may cost just $8 per trade.

However suppose disaster truly does strike. How would you redeem your gold if it's being in a depository halfway throughout the country? To deal with that issue, a few alternative IRA advisors point to a wrinkle in the tax code that they say might let you save your precious metals close by such as in a regional bank safe deposit box or in the house. Basically, the business helps you establish what's called a minimal liability business (LLC) and location that company into a self-directed IRA. The LLC then buys the gold and chooses where to keep it. The downside to this strategy is that it appears to run counter to the dreams of the Irs (IRS).

Tax issues aside, financial experts state there is a much more affordable method to add gold to your retirement portfolio: purchase an Exchange-Traded Fund (ETF) that tracks the cost of the metal. These funds like SPDR Gold Shares, IShares Gold Trust, ETFS Physical Swiss Gold Shares and others are essentially trusts that own vast quantities of gold bullion - 401k gold rollover. SPDR Gold, for example, has nearly $34 billion in gold bars tucked in a huge underground vault in London where employees in titanium-toed shoes drive the stuff around on forklifts.

There's no minimum financial investment except the cost of a single share, which recently varied from around $5 to roughly $120, depending on the ETF. And since the funds purchase and store gold in bulk, their operating costs are comparatively low (gold 401k rollover - work directly with owners). SPDR Gold's annual costs are capped at 4/10 of a percent of holdings each year, for example, or somewhere between the cost of an index fund and an actively managed fund.
